God is still at work

For the word of the Lord is upright, and all his work is done in faithfulness.

Psalm 33:4



The Pharisees were making trouble for Jesus – again. They were legalistic in their approach to the laws of both God and man, usually to show their own piety. It was the Sabbath, and Jewish law and custom had a good deal to say about Sabbath rest and the work that should not be done. Yet, Jesus came by a man, an invalid, to whom He simply said, “Get up, take up your bed and walk.” Which, of course, the man did. The Jewish leaders understood this spoken word as work and a Sabbath violation, so they persecuted the Savior, pushing Him to explain how it was that He would do such a thing on the Sabbath. Jesus simply answered them, “My Father is working until now, and I am working.”


God is still at work in the lives of His children, and in nations around the globe. An examination of American history reveals His presence with early settlers, colonists, the framers of the nation’s liberty, and its continued blessings. History is also replete with the wreckage of nations that forgot God… something the United States has increasingly been doing. In your time of intercession, lift up politicians and their complacent constituents before the Lord in prayer, asking that the Holy Spirit would work in their lives, drawing them to the Savior.


Jesus said you are both salt and light. He earnestly desires for you to draw others to Him. God is still working and He is in control. He has been faithful.
